Stop At: Giant Panda Breeding Research Base (Xiongmao Jidi), No.1375 Xiongmao Avenue the Outside Northern Third Ring Road, Chenghua District, Chengdu 610081 China

Chengdu Research Base is a non-profit research and breeding facility for giant pandas and the red pandas. There are more than 180 giant pandas, subadults and panda cubs living in the panda base. The travelers have an opportunity to see the newborn cubs in Summer.

Stop At: Wenshu Yuan Monastery, No.66 Wenshuyuan Street, Qingyang District, Chengdu 610017 China

Wenshu Monastery is a famous Buddhist temple in the west of Sichuan Province. Covering 13.5 acres with over 190 halls and rooms, Wenshu Monastery rides north to south and appeals to a great many visitors home and abroad by its graceful garden, solemn halls, and masses of cultural relics. As a provincial officially protected site, the whole Wenshu Monastery is an enclosing quadrangle courtyard with classical architectures in the style of Qing Dynasty (1644-1911) standing on the central axis, such as the Hall of Heavenly Kings, Mahavira Hall, the Three Persons Hall, Preaching Hall, and Sutra Hall, as well as a complete set of a temple on both sides, like Chan room, Buddhist hall, Fast rooms, Guests rooms, etc. and the Bell Tower and Drum Tower stand facing each other. In addition, there is a bronze bell over 4500 kilograms hanging in the Bell Tower.

Stop At: Chengdu Renmin Park, No.12 Shaocheng Road, Qingyang District, Chengdu 610015 China

Originally built in 1911 and covers 11 hectares, People’s Park (Renmin Park), is the largest as well as the earliest park of Chengdu established in the city center. The park was also the locality of many a historical event. Extended for several times, the present Renmin Park is a developed one combined gardening, culture, tea-tasting, leisure and recreation. The graceful park houses a nationally protected cultural site, four municipality protected historical sites, more than 70 kinds of famous trees and couples of plants gardens; various exhibitions and performances also take turns here. Teahouse, lotus ponds, walking paths, pavilions and resting spots make the park a popular haunt for Chengdu locals since its establishment.

Stop At: Kuanzhai Alley Waiwei Parking Lot Er, M382+HHQ, Xia Tong Ren Lu, Qing Yang Qu, Cheng Du Shi, Si Chuan Sheng, China, 610032

Located in Chengdu’s Qingyang district, the three parallel alleys of Kuanzhai Lane (China’s Lane) offer a lively mix of old and new, with renovated and restored buildings that date from the Qing dynasty. A popular shopping, dining, entertainment, and tourist destination, it’s also one of the city’s three historic conservation districts.
